In the heart of Astana, Kazakhstan, a group of young enthusiasts recently embarked on an exciting eco-adventure, thanks to the Global Green Hub and the support of the city akimat. This event was part of the "Taza Kazakhstan" campaign, a nationwide initiative aimed at fostering environmental responsibility and care for nature among the population.

The main participants of the day were children, who were eager to learn and make a difference. One of the youngest participants, Daulet, at the tender age of 5, expressed his ambition to become an eco-engineer in the future. Another young participant, Alina, showcased her innovative thinking by creating a project for a flower that indicates clean air.

The eco-quest was set in the bustling TРЦ Arsenal, where characters named Zara, Mo, and T9 guided the children through a series of ecological tasks. The goal was to inspire the young participants to think like eco-engineers and solve problems related to the environment.

Volunteer Aysyl Ergaliyeva emphasised the importance of events like these, stating that they promote care for nature, waste sorting, tree planting, and responsibility. The "Astana Jastary" Youth Resource Center provided additional volunteers for the eco-event.

The Taza Kazakhstan campaign, launched by President Kassym-Jomart Tokayev, promotes sustainable development through public clean-up efforts, tree-planting drives, digital environmental monitoring, and advanced nature conservation technologies. It encourages community participation in ecological projects and links environmental stewardship with economic development and youth engagement in preserving natural landscapes through innovative tourism ventures.

In Astana, this campaign includes organizing eco-quests and special tours that combine environmental awareness with career guidance in industrial and technological professions. These events introduce young participants to environmental issues and modern eco-friendly technologies while inspiring interest in technical vocations and entrepreneurship related to sustainability.
